The Unmatched Performance Attributes of the 2025 Ford Mustang

High-Octane Muscle

The 2025 Mustang offers three high-powered engines to suit different preferences. The base EcoBoost Mustang is powered by an eager and responsive 2.3-liter turbo-four that pushes out a remarkable 315 ponies and 350 lb-ft of torque, allowing the standard Mustang to go from 0 to 60 in 4.5 seconds! And thanks to its cutting-edge modular power cylinder engine architecture, the EcoBoost is jaw-droppingly efficient, getting up to 33 MPG on the highway, meaning you can comfortably daily-drive this beast.

Those who insist on having V8 muscle under the hood can choose between two variants of the sonorous fourth-generation 5.0-liter Coyote V8 engine. The Mustang GT's Coyote generates up to a whopping 486 HP and 418 pound-feet of torque, sending the GT to 60 in 3.9 seconds. The track-ready Mustang Dark Horse utilizes a tuned version of the Coyote that cranks out a stupendous 500 HP, rocketing it to 60 in 3.7 seconds to ensure undisputed dominance on the track.

Thrilling Performance Features

The Mustang comes with a wealth of available high-performance features to ensure maximum capability and enjoyment whenever you get behind its wheel. Thanks to standard rear-wheel drive, it enjoys near-perfect weight distribution, which results in outstanding balance and stability, allowing you to execute high-speed maneuvers with confidence. To improve your grip even further, the Torsen limited-slip rear differential optimizes torque distribution to ensure maximum traction, while the Pirelli P Zero high-performance tires adhere to the asphalt tenaciously.

The MagneRide adaptive suspension adjusts its shocks up to 1,000 times per second to ensure the most optimal suspension settings for every road condition and driving mood, while the responsive and pinpoint accurate rack-and-pinion steering delivers satisfying feedback. Together, these elements allow the Mustang to dance through curves with effortless grace. And with the available six-speed manual coming with rev-matching and no-lift shifting capabilities to ensure engaging, soul-soothing transitions, handling this bad boy is nothing short of a delight.

The 2025 Ford Explorer: A SUV for All Adventures

With legendary versatility, three rows of comfort, and plenty of convenient technology for long drives, the 2025 Ford Explorer is a reliable full-size SUV that can easily enhance every journey. Two Reliable Engines This edition has four trim levels and two engines to offer to meet different needs. Most trim levels come with a turbocharged 2.3-liter I-4 engine that generates an impressive 300 horsepower. As impressive as that is, the second engine provides an even sportier response, as it's a 400-horsepower 3.0-liter, which is also turbocharged. Regardless of which of these engines you go with, both are capable of towing up to 5,000 pounds when paired with the available Class III Trailer Package. more Powerful Versatility Also versatile in different scenarios, this SUV offers an available Intelligent 4WD System, which can jump into action to increase traction as needed. While this system automatically responds and comes with Hill Descent, it also works alongside the standard Selectable Drive Modes, which give you control over the vehicle's performance and traction by providing multiple driving modes to choose from, like Sport, Eco, Trail, Tow/Haul, and, in models with 4WD, Deep Snow/Sand. A Comfortable Cabin Also offering plenty of comfort inside its three-row cabin, this edition has tri-zone climate control with rear climate auxiliary controls, as well as foldable rear seats that can quickly make more room for cargo when in a hurry. The third-row seat has a power-folding function, and the second-row E-Z Entry seats can also slide forward. Select upper trims also have multicontour heated and ventilated front seats with Active Motion massage, as well as heated rear seats. Entertainment for All Throughout the vehicle's cabin is plenty of advanced technology to enhance drives, like the standard Ford Digital Experience, a multi-function infotainment system with voice-activated controls, a full-color touchscreen, and wireless support for Apple and Android devices. This system pairs with a six-speaker AM/FM audio system that has MP3 compatibility, while push-button start, 5G LTE Wi-Fi hotspot capability (which works with an internet data plan), and a full-color 12.3-inch instrument cluster behind the wheel are all included as well. Sophisticated Safety Driver-assist highlights include standard BLIS (Blind Spot Information System) with Cross-Traffic Alert, Lane-Keeping System, and Pre-Collision Assist with Automatic Emergency Braking and Pedestrian Detection. In parking lots, the rear view camera and rear parking sensors, also standard, can help you visualize or detect hazards. Every model also includes Evasive Steering Assist, Post-Collision Braking, Trailer Sway Control, and the Individual Tire Pressure Monitoring System. Trim Levels of the 2025 Ford Expedition: Space and Luxury

If you're in the market for an SUV that delivers on power, space, and luxury, the 2025 Ford Expedition should be at the top of your list. We discuss the four trim configurations that help drivers tailor the Expedition to their lifestyle. 1. Active We begin with the Active: a three-row, eight-seater SUV powered by a 400-horsepower 3.5-liter EcoBoost V6. Complementing the impressive power is a rugged exterior with a carbon-black grille, LED reflector headlights, configurable daytime running lights, and 18-inch aluminum wheels. The Active's spacious interior boasts many features usually missing on other base trims, such as tri-zone automatic climate control and a power tilt and telescoping steering wheel. Power-adjustable seats are installed at the front, with the driver's being adjustable in 10 different ways. Dominating the dashboard are two large display screens: a 24-inch panoramic instrument panel and a 13.2-inch infotainment touchscreen with 5G Wi-Fi hotspot capability. more 2. Platinum Next is the Platinum, which builds in luxury and creature comforts. An ebony, silver, and chrome grille and 20-inch ebony machined wheels help set this trim apart from the Active. Power deployable running boards make it easier for everyone to climb on board. Inside, the Platinum's new panoramic sunroof brightens up the cabin. Leather now lines the upholstery, including the heated and ventilated front seats. Bucket seats replace the bench seating in the second row, transforming this trim into a seven-seater. Drivers receive towing assistance from a heavy-duty trailering package. A 10-speaker Bang & Olufsen audio system improves the sound quality throughout the cabin, and a memory feature allows drivers to save their seat, mirror, and pedal settings. 3. Tremor The Tremor is the Expedition for adventurers and thrill-seekers. This off-road-enhanced SUV gains a high-output V6 engine, which pushes the horsepower to 440 ponies and the torque to 510 pound-feet. A high-flow exhaust system improves performance. Skid plates and underbody armor protect the transmission and fuel tank when traversing rough terrain. Ford also gives the Tremor a revamped grille, adding carbonized gray bars, an ebony-colored mesh, and signature lighting. 4. King Ranch Where the Tremor tops the list for off-road prowess, the King Ranch leads the way in terms of luxury. Ford gives its top Expedition a southwest flair for a more sophisticated finish, adding sinister bronze bars on the grille and changing the wheels to sinister bronze 22-inch diamond-cut ones. The interior also receives an upgrade, gaining Del Rio leather-lined seating, ebony Mesa Del Rio on the steering wheel and center console, and a premium 22-speaker B&O sound system. Whether your priority is budget, off-road capability, or creature comforts, there's an Expedition that fits the bill. 5 Features That Make the 2025 Ford Bronco Sport Stand Out

Adventurous, stylish, and with impressive fuel efficiency, the 2025 Ford Bronco Sport combines versatility with cutting-edge technology, and offers these five key features, along with a unique design, that help it stand out among other compact crossover SUVs. 1. A 250-HP 2.0-liter Engine This edition has two engines for you to choose from: a turbocharged 1.5-liter and a 2.0-liter, also turbocharged. While the 181-horsepower 1.5-liter is ideal for fuel-conscious drivers with its 28 MPG in estimated combined city/highway mileage, the 2.0-liter provides a nice balance of both strong output and fuel efficiency, as it delivers 250 horsepower and 277 pound-feet of torque while getting 23 MPG in combined mileage and towing up to 2,700 pounds. more 2. An Advanced 4x4 System Every 2025 Bronco Sport has an advanced 4x4 system that easily conquers most off-road challenges, as well as slippery and snow-covered roads. This is complemented by an off-road suspension, as well as G.O.A.T. Modes, a terrain management system that has multiple drive modes you can select from to optimize traction, shifting, and engine throttling. The rugged Badlands trim adds a twin-clutch rear differential, skid plates, and Bilstein rear dampers for even greater versatility. 3. Infotainment in Full Color Another standard offering is the SYNC 4 infotainment system, a convenient multi-function feature that pairs a full-color 13.2-inch touchscreen display with voice controls and AppLink for downloading apps. Not only can you pair both Apple and Android devices to this system via Bluetooth to stream media, but you can also adjust driver preference settings with it and hands-free calls and texts. A six-speaker AM/FM audio system pairs with this system and a 10-speaker Bose audio system is available. 4. A Roof You Can Camp On One of the more unique and noticeable features found on this SUV is its safari-style roof, which has been designed to hold up to 150 pounds of cargo while stationary and 100 pounds while driving. It also allows you to attach third-party accessories to it, such as bicycle racks and cargo boxes, and you can even camp out on top of it with a roof-mounted tent. Best of all, it expands headspace inside the cabin, perfect for taller passengers. 5. 360-Degree Camera Views Many of the vehicle's tech features make off-roading easier, like the available the HD Surround Vision camera system provides 360-degree views around the vehicle. This system also lets you toggle between both ground-level and bird's-eye angles and makes parking and hitching up to trailers easier as well. This system is offered alongside the 180-degree Trail Cam, also available, and a cruise control-like feature for off-roading called Trail Control, which is available for Outer Banks models and standard with Badlands.
